Abstract: |
The scattering characteristics of sand/dust particles were analyzed using Mie theory. The attenuation characteristic of infrared electromagnetic wave propagation in sand and dust with special size distribution was studied. The results showed that the attenuation of exponential distribution is very close to that of the Log-normal distribution, and decreases with visibility. From the calculation results of different sand weather at a wavelength of11μm, it was shown that sand-dust storm causes the highest attenuation, while the natural sand gives the lowest attenuation. |
